The patient has been experiencing difficulty and straining when expelling feces. Which intervention should the nurse discuss with the client:

a) Encourage the client to use a cathartic laxative on a daily basis
b) Place the client on a high fiber diet


Answer: b) Place the client on a high fiber diet
